Neatresse

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    A woman who takes care of cattle. nonce-word, obsolete

    "The Neatreſſe longing for the reſt, did egge him on to tell / How faire ſhe vvas, and vvho ſhe vvas."

Etymology

From neat (“cattle collectively”) + -resse.
